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2018479788 87 78 91 93247426
693443 4376
693443 4376
595233 52937155538 81 04
All about undefined
Interested in learning more?
693443 4376
595233 52937155538 81 04
See more
1804605555 11 98472296258
26610988 025173 64985683281
See more
3697 2884999919
81 44622477 40253
See more